ETN vs J in plain English
- ETN is the bigger company — about 10.5× the market cap of J.
- ETN is cheaper on earnings (P/E 46.7 vs 48.9).
- ETN earns a higher return on equity (20% vs 8%).
- J is growing revenue faster (34% vs 21%).
- J has the higher dividend yield (0.98% vs 0.96%).
